Ruff Motors needs to select an assembly line for producing their new SUV. They have two options: • Option A is a highly automated assembly line that has a large up-front cost but low maintenance cost over the years. This option will cost $8 million today with a yearly operating cost of $2 million. The assembly line will last for 5 years and be sold for $5 million in 5 years. • Option B is a cheaper alternative with less technology, a longer life, but higher operating costs. This option will cost $7 million today with an annual operating cost of $2.5 million. This assembly line will last for 8 years and be sold for $1 million in 8 years. The firm’s cost of capital is 12%. Assume a tax rate of zero percent. The equivalent annual cost (EAC) for Option A is $_______ million. The equivalent annual cost (EAC) for Option B is $_______ million.
